J512 - Top Rare fully Rooted cf Lapparentosaurus Titanosauriform / Basal Brachiosaurid Dinosaur Tooth - Middle Jurassic Aragonite The scales of many ofHere we present a particularly rare specimen: a fully rooted tooth from a rather controversial dinosaur. Its tooth morphotype has been attributed to either a basal brachiosaurid or at least a titanosauriform. It is currently assigned the ID cf. Lapparentosaurus, although the debate is still ongoing within the scientific community. Observations about the especimen: Fully rooted and completely natural.
